Description
Fluctuation dynamos could be important in generating the first magnetic fields in galaxies and also maintaining the fields in galaxy clusters. Mean field dynamos would be important in explaining the fields on scales larger than the scale of the forcing. An issue which is often debated is whether the generated fields are coherent enough to explain the observations. This talk focuses on this issue and discusses various lines of evidence which suggests that these dynamos can indeed produce coherent enough fields. Further, the issue of how to explain magnetic spiral arms seen in several disk galaxies is also addressed.
